SULTAN SINGH
MADAN LAL SETH – Appellant
Versus
AMAR SINGH BHALLA – Respondent
( 1 ) THIS is a tenant s appeal under Section 39 of the Delhi Rent Control Act, 1958 (hereinafter called the Act ) against the Judgment and order of the Rent Control Tribunal dated March 10, 1978 which dismissed the appeal from the Additional Controller s order dated 18th May, 1977. The respondent-landlord let out portions of first floor and second floor of House No. 1/2, West Patel Nagar, New Delhi at the monthly rent of Rs. 225. 00 besides electricity and water charges to the appellant in 1956. On 13th July, 1971 he filed a petition for eviction on ground of non-payment of rent. An order under Section 15 (1) of the Act was passed by the Controller on 20th October, 1971 requiring the tenant to pay arrears of rent and future rent. An appeal filed by the tenant was dismissed by Rent Control Tribunal. The tenant deposited the rents complying with the order under Section 15 (1) of the Act with the result the eviction petition was dismissed on 25th August, 1973 holding that the tenant has availed the benefit of Section 14 (2) of the Act.
